Her mother tells her no, that there are lots of other Indian outfits she can wear such as a chaniya choli, a cropped Indian top with a long, full skirt.   Eventually, the mother realises how important it is for her little girl to feel like a big girl and dresses up her daughter in the complicated and ornate folds of a blue sari, adding a bindi to her forehead as a final touch.  Feeling grown-up and pretty, the daughter embraces her mother, thrilled to be just like her, even if just for a moment.","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"GB \/ VERY_G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":49629221847313,"sku":"GOR010068898","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"US \/ G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":50468085235985,"sku":"CIN0316011053G","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"US \/ VERY_G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":51805123346705,"sku":"CIN0316011053VG","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":53391243084049,"sku":"GOR003664790","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/0316011053.jpg?v=1751421872"},{"product_id":"under-her-skin-book-pooja-makhijani-9781580051170","title":"Under Her Skin","description":"Not since Scout relayed her innocent, yet stark, fictional awakening to racial injustice in  To Kill a Mockingbird  has the influence of race on the world of children been painted with such delicate clarity as in this collection. Including the perspectives of women of colour, white women, and those caught in between,  Under Her Skin  traces themes related to double lives, fear, envy, lineage, and family, broadening our understanding of the often-painful subject of racial difference. Essays include the reflections of a woman whose girlhood is spent deciphering levels of oppression,from her Jewish family's internment in the camps to her own treatment of their African-American maids a radical parallel forged between a half-Nigerian narrator and three generations of Finnish male immigrants whom she claims as kin and the startling connection of a white fourteen year old to Emmett Till through the photograph found on his lifeless body.
